Corey's '09 HS Graduation Cake
I used yellow cake mix and then iced with homemade buttercreme icing. The graduation cap is made of a 6" yellow cake that was cut at a slant after it cooled, it was then iced with buttercreme icing.
I cut a 6" square cakeboard to make the top of the cap. A thin layer of icing was placed on it. I used a #6 tip to ice a border around the cap top and bottom of the cap. I attached the tassel(which I found was a keychain I broke down to make work on the cake). I also placed dowel rods under the cap to ensure it didn't sink down into the cake.
My son loved his cake and so did all the guests.
